A 99% vegan smoothie bar and plant based eatery (offers bee pollen as an add-on and as an ingredient in one of the smoothies). Serves gourmet smoothies and bites to elevate wellness. Open Mon-Fri 9:00am-6:30pm, Sat-Sun 9:30am-6:30pm.

Read moreThis hidden gem tucked away on a quiet street in the Lumphini area, and it feels like stepping into a different world. The shop is super cool and futuristic. Despite being a small smoothie bar, the food menu is surprisingly big and hearty. I loved the ‘Taste of Seoul’ wrap, which was packed with kimchi, tempeh, and a vegan cream cheese dip that was so flavourful. The rice balls were also amazing (I loved the Tom Yum and the seaweed flavours).
Of course, the smoothies are the main event here. They blend them fresh right in front of you using whole foods and serve them in these cute, sealed cans. I tried the ‘Deep Ocean’ with blueberry and spirulina and it was yummy.
Just a heads up: Almost everything is vegan, but one of the smoothies contains bee pollen.
Pros: Surprisingly great food for a smoothie shop, Smoothies are fresh and come in a cute can

A compact smoothie bar and plant based foods. I tried the superfoods salad which was yummy with lots of delicious high quality ingredients such as beetroot, figs and almonds. They advertise as a plant based eatery but are not fully vegan due to the bee pollen add-on and as an ingredient in their Earlflower smoothie. The protein powder add on used is fully plant based.
